OTTAWA, Canada—The Canadian government has postponed the release of its final regulations for cryptocurrency and blockchain companies. The final published regulations were due this fall, but the government now says they won’t be published in the Canada Gazette until late 2019.

WASHINGTON—Total retail sales rose for the seventh consecutive month in August, but at a slower pace: August saw 0.1% growth while July's sales growth was revised up to 0.7%.

ARLINGTON, Va. – NAFCU has published a new white paper that calls on Congress to consider the benefits of creating a modernized Glass-Steagall Act in order to protect consumers from banks that are “too big to fail.”
